MOUNT LIBRARY TUTORIALS
Introduction to the APA 7th Edition
Citation Style
The Publication Manual of the
American Psychological
Association (APA) is used for
academic writing in the social
sciences and related fields.
The manual explains how to
cite sources as well as many
aspects of writing and
formatting research papers.
APA 7th Edition
• APA 7th edition was released in October 2019
• It includes updates and changes, such as new ways of citing
electronic sources and the use of inclusive and bias-free
language.
When should you cite?
• Any time you paraphrase. Paraphrasing is when you take an
idea from the text and rewrite it in a different way.
• Any time you quote directly from a source.
• Any time you write about something that came from a book,
journal article, website, or any other source.
Every source you use to write a research assignment must be cited.
How should you cite paraphrased ideas?
• Cite your sources within the text of your essay.
• One author:
(Author’s Last Name, Year)
(Parkinson, 2009)
• Two authors:
(First Author’s Last Name & Second Author’s Last Name, Year)
(Caplivski & Sheld, 2011)
• Three or more authors:
(First Author’s Last Name et al., Year)
(Cohen et al., 2018)
In-text citations for paraphrased ideas
When you paraphrase an author’s ideas, you must include
the author’s last name and the year of publication.
One way to do this is by putting the authors’ last names
and year of publication in parentheses before the closing
punctuation at the end of the sentence.
Another way is to cite paraphrased ideas using narrative
citations in which the author and date information is included
as part of your sentence.
In-text citations for paraphrased ideas
How should you cite an author’s exact words?
• If the quote is fewer than 40 words:
• Place quotation marks around the text copied from your
source.
• Use page numbers when available, e.g. p. 35 or pp. 35-36.
• Use paragraph numbers when quoting from sources with
no page number, e.g. para. 18
In-text citations for direct quotes: fewer than 40 words
When you directly quote an author’s words,
you must include the author’s last name, year
of publication, and the page number(s) for the
quote.
Write the author’s last name, year, and page number in
parentheses after the closing quotation marks but before
the period.
How should you cite an author’s exact words?
• If the quote is 40 words or more:
• Do not use quotation marks.
• Start the block quotation on a new line indented 0.5
inches from the left margin.
• Cite the source in parentheses after the quotation’s
closing punctuation.
OR
• Cite the author and year in the narrative before the
quotation, then write only the page number in
parentheses after the quotation’s closing punctuation.

What is an indirect citation?
• An indirect citation is when you paraphrase or quote a source that is
cited or quoted in another source.
• For example, you might want to use a quote from an article, but then
notice the quote is followed by an in-text citation with the author and
date of a different article.
This quote is an indirect source if you use it in your paper. because you want to
use a quote or paraphrase without seeing the original source or context.
How should you cite an indirect source?
There are two ways you can deal with an indirect source
1. You can find the original source and cite it directly. In the example
from the previous slide, you could find the original article written
by Lea in 1998 and cite it. This is the recommended way of citing
sources whenever possible.
OR
2. You can use an indirect in-text citation to give credit to the original
author but let the reader know you did not read the original article.
Only include the source you read in your reference list at the end of your
essay. You do not need to include the indirect source (Lea, 1998).

Reference List
• At the end of your document, you should include a list of every
source you used in your paper
• List your sources in alphabetical order
• Double space your list
• Use hanging indentation
